当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

服务器虚拟机和物理机的区别是什么呢英文翻译,Differences Between Server Virtual Machines and Physical Machines

服务器虚拟机和物理机的区别是什么呢英文翻译,Differences Between Server Virtual Machines and Physical Machines

Differences Between Server Virtual Machines and Physical Machines refer to the dispa...

Differences Between Server Virtual Machines and Physical Machines refer to the disparities in how computing resources are utilized. Virtual machines simulate hardware on a single physical server, allowing multiple OS instances to run simultaneously, while physical machines are dedicated to a single OS and hardware. Virtual machines offer flexibility and efficiency, whereas physical machines provide better performance and control.

The world of server computing has seen a significant evolution over the years, with virtualization becoming a cornerstone of modern IT infrastructures. Server virtual machines (VMs) and physical machines (PMs) are two primary components of this ecosystem, each with its unique characteristics and use cases. This article aims to delve into the differences between server virtual machines and physical machines, highlighting their functionalities, advantages, and limitations.

1、Definition

Server Virtual Machines: A server virtual machine is a software-based emulation of a physical computer that can run an operating system and applications independently of the underlying hardware. VMs are created by dividing a physical server into multiple virtual environments, allowing multiple operating systems to coexist on a single physical machine.

Physical Machines: Physical machines, also known as bare-metal servers, are the traditional hardware-based servers that house the operating systems and applications. They are standalone devices with dedicated hardware resources, such as CPU, RAM, storage, and network interfaces.

2、Architecture

服务器虚拟机和物理机的区别是什么呢英文翻译,Differences Between Server Virtual Machines and Physical Machines

Server Virtual Machines: Virtual machines operate on a hypervisor, which is a layer of software that abstracts the underlying hardware and allows multiple VMs to run concurrently. The hypervisor manages the allocation of physical resources to VMs, ensuring efficient resource utilization.

Physical Machines: Physical machines do not have a hypervisor. They directly interact with the hardware and run the operating system and applications on dedicated resources.

3、Performance

Server Virtual Machines: VM performance is often affected by the number of VMs running on a physical server, as well as the resource allocation strategy employed by the hypervisor. This can lead to performance bottlenecks, especially when resource-intensive applications are running.

Physical Machines: Physical machines offer better performance for resource-intensive applications, as they have dedicated hardware resources. However, this also means that physical machines may have underutilized resources when running less demanding workloads.

4、Scalability

Server Virtual Machines: VMs offer excellent scalability, as additional VMs can be easily created and managed within the same physical server. This allows for efficient resource utilization and cost savings, as physical servers can host multiple VMs.

Physical Machines: Physical machines have limited scalability, as adding more resources to a single server can be expensive and time-consuming. Upgrading a physical machine may also require downtime.

服务器虚拟机和物理机的区别是什么呢英文翻译,Differences Between Server Virtual Machines and Physical Machines

5、Resource Allocation

Server Virtual Machines: Resource allocation in VMs is managed by the hypervisor, which can dynamically adjust resources based on workload demands. This can lead to improved efficiency and better resource utilization.

Physical Machines: Resource allocation in physical machines is fixed, as the hardware resources are dedicated to a single operating system and application. This can result in underutilized resources when running less demanding workloads.

6、Maintenance and Management

Server Virtual Machines: VMs are easier to maintain and manage, as they can be provisioned, updated, and scaled without impacting the underlying physical hardware. VM management tools and automation can further streamline the process.

Physical Machines: Physical machines require more manual maintenance and management, as they involve direct interaction with the hardware. This can be time-consuming and may require specialized knowledge.

7、Security

Server Virtual Machines: VMs can be isolated from one another, providing a level of security that is not always possible with physical machines. However, vulnerabilities in the hypervisor or VM management tools can still pose security risks.

服务器虚拟机和物理机的区别是什么呢英文翻译,Differences Between Server Virtual Machines and Physical Machines

Physical Machines: Physical machines can offer better security, as they are not directly connected to the virtual environment. However, physical security measures, such as securing the server room, are essential to prevent unauthorized access.

8、Cost

Server Virtual Machines: VMs can be more cost-effective, as they allow for better resource utilization and can reduce the number of physical servers required. However, the cost of virtualization software and management tools should be considered.

Physical Machines: Physical machines can be more expensive, as they require dedicated hardware resources and may have higher power consumption. However, they can be more cost-effective for certain workloads that require high performance and dedicated resources.

In conclusion, server virtual machines and physical machines have distinct differences in terms of architecture, performance, scalability, resource allocation, maintenance, security, and cost. The choice between the two depends on the specific requirements of the workload and the IT infrastructure. Organizations should carefully evaluate their needs and consider the advantages and limitations of each option before making a decision.

黑狐家游戏

发表评论

最新文章